Welcome to Anna ...

Anna is located in Baker County<1>.


We aren't confident of the location of Anna, so consider the above location as an estimate.<2>


While we don't have a date for the founding of Anna, you might consider that their post office opened  in 1904.

Time Zone: Anna l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Note: If you travel west from Anna (for example, toward Gordon (AL)), you will leave Eastern Time and cross into the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T).

Anna is within the (229) area code.

Adding Anna to Our Gazetteer ...

The earliest source we've referenced which mentioned Anna was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<5>

From that list, the Anna post office opened in 1904.

We also found Anna on a map titled Rand McNally Map of Georgia (1911).
